I use jQuery file upload blueimp and have read

$(function () {
    $('#fileupload').fileupload({
        dataType: 'json',
        done: function (e, data) {
            $.each(data.result, function (index, file) {
                $('<p/>').text(file.name).appendTo(document.body);
            });
        },
        add:function (e, data) {
            $("#uploadBtn").off('click').on('click',function () {
                data.submit();
            });
        }
    });
});

but this uploads a single file, I want to upload all files that have been selected.

your problem is that you unbind the click event on every file. you should do it on done:

done: function (e, data) {
            $("#uploadBtn").off('click')
            $.each(data.result, function (index, file) {
                $('<p/>').text(file.name).appendTo(document.body);
            });
        },
add: function (e, data) {
            $("#uploadBtn").on('click',function () {
                data.submit();
            });
        }

For upload concurrently all file you have selected, you can add the option autoUpload: true, like this:

$('#fileupload').fileupload({
    url: 'url_path',
    autoUpload: true
})
